Strongs Number: G4949
- Greek Word
- Συροφοίνισσα
- Transliteration
- Surophoinissa
- Phonetic
- soo-rof-oy'-nis-sah
- Part of Speech
- Noun Feminine
- Strongs Definition
-
a Syro-Phaenician woman that is a female native of Phaenicia in Syria
- Thayers Definition
-
Syrophenician = "exalted palm"
1. the name of a mixed nation, half Phoenicians and half Syrians
- Origin
- Feminine of a compound of G4948 and the same as G5403
- Bible Usage
- Syrophenician.
